High Efficiency Combustion Systems for Radiant Tubes

D. E. Quinn, North American Mfg. Co., Cleveland, OH

View in WORD format

Summary: Radiant tubes combustion systems are used extensively throughout the Heat Treating industry. Recent and sustaining increases in natural gas prices coupled with volatility in pricing and supply have resulted in significant threats to the profit margins for heat treating facilities. This paper discusses some new radiant tube combustion technologies that will improve the bottom line profits by significantly increasing fuel efficiency, improving radiant tube life and potentially improve production, depending on current furnace configuration.
